Counselling

Using active listening, confidentiality, discretion, and calm interpersonal support to help staff, participants, and community members access resources.

02

Support

Creating safe, inclusive environments where people feel respected, encouraged, and able to participate with dignity.

03

Advocacy

Representing community needs with funders, agencies, boards, and partners while keeping equity and inclusion at the centre.

04

Group Work

Leading meetings and small-group settings that give staff and stakeholders a real voice in decisions and shared goals.

05

Organization Management

Managing programs, budgets, governance relationships, staff engagement, HR, funding, contracts, and multi-service operations.

06

Community Development

Building partnerships across diverse communities, institutions, funders, and cultural groups to strengthen connection and belonging.

07

Outreach

Increasing visibility through events, workshops, donor relations, volunteer engagement, and community representation.
